Human Resources (HR) Meaning and Responsibilities.

Human resources (HR) is the department within a business that is responsible for all aspects of employee management. This includes recruitment, training, benefits, and payroll. HR is also responsible for ensuring that all company policies and procedures are followed.

The main responsibilities of HR are to attract, hire, and retain employees. They also work to improve employee morale and motivation. Additionally, HR is responsible for keeping up with changes in employment law and ensuring that the company complies with all applicable regulations.

HR plays a vital role in the success of any business. They are responsible for ensuring that the company has the right mix of talent, that employees are properly trained and developed, and that they are motivated to do their best work.

What are the 4 components of human resources? 1) Compensation and benefits: This includes wages, salaries, bonuses, and other forms of financial compensation, as well as benefits such as health insurance and retirement plans.

2) Employee relations: This encompasses all of the ways in which HR professionals interact with employees, including communication, training, and conflict resolution.

3) Recruitment and selection: HR professionals are responsible for attracting and hiring the best talent for their organization. This involves everything from writing job descriptions to conducting interviews.

4) Human resources management: This is the strategic side of HR, involving the development and implementation of programs and policies that help an organization achieve its goals. This can encompass everything from workforce planning to training and development.

What are the 3 main responsibilities of human resources? The three main responsibilities of human resources are attracting, developing, and retaining employees.

1. Attracting employees: Human resources is responsible for attracting top talent to the organization. This includes advertising open positions, screening resumes, conducting interviews, and extending job offers.

2. Developing employees: Once employees are hired, human resources is responsible for development initiatives. This includes creating training and development programs, managing performance, and providing career growth opportunities.

3. Retaining employees: Human resources is responsible for retaining employees through initiatives such as offering competitive benefits, enforcing company policies, and creating a positive work environment.

What is an HR structure?

The human resources (HR) structure of a business refers to the way in which the HR department is organised and the way in which it operates. The HR structure of a business will be influenced by the size of the business, the nature of its operations and the way in which it is organised.

What technical skills are needed for human resources?

The technical skills needed for human resources generally fall into two categories: those related to HR management and those related to HRIS (Human Resources Information Systems).

HR management skills include the ability to develop and implement HR policies and procedures, to create and maintain employee records, to administer payroll and benefits, and to conduct performance appraisals. HRIS skills include the ability to use HRIS software to manage employee data, to generate reports, and to support the recruitment and selection process.

In order to be successful in an HR career, it is important to have strong communication and interpersonal skills, as well as a solid understanding of business principles. In addition, as HR functions become increasingly reliant on technology, it is important to have strong computer skills and be comfortable working with different types of HRIS software.
